37 Commits (1793ee804e8e6d41fbbc1efe27ec0e20866a0750)

Author SHA1 Message Date
Randy Mackay a53d1075ec DataFlash: add EnableWrites method 11 years ago
Andrew Tridgell a37a6d68f3 DataFlash: zero-fill FMT packet before logging 11 years ago
Andrew Tridgell 599edeeafb DataFlash: removed debug code for creating logs with no headers 11 years ago
Andrew Tridgell e6bafa2d8f DataFlash: added structures to Init() of dataflash 11 years ago
Andrew Tridgell 5d53b780ba DataFlash: added functions for load download support 11 years ago
Andrew Tridgell 513f4074ce DataFlash: fixed dual sensor dataflash logging 11 years ago
Andrew Tridgell 08658909ad DataFlash: log both IMU packets at once 11 years ago
Andrew Tridgell a6b3d4217c DataFlash: fixes for INS API change 11 years ago
Andrew Tridgell eb883fbb0c DataFlash: added Log_Write_IMU2() for logging 2nd INS sensors 11 years ago
Randy Mackay ef2597a626 DataFlash: rename Log_Write_SERVO to Log_Write_RCOU 11 years ago
Andrew Tridgell 825b360fb0 DataFlash: added RCIN and SRVO log methods 11 years ago
Andrew Tridgell 3262022195 DataFlash: print FMT messages for wrapped logs 11 years ago
Andrew Tridgell 1fb636d57f DataFlash: added APM time and GPS velz to logged GPS messages 11 years ago
Andrew Tridgell 5e915fbde3 DataFlash: added timestamp to IMU and VelZ to GPS logging 11 years ago
Andrew Tridgell 4e82a8e1d4 DataFlash: use const ins reference 11 years ago
Andrew Tridgell d7a9888e26 DataFlash: updates for new GPS API 11 years ago
Andrew Tridgell 99a8ba4634 DataFlash: fixed display of last page of flash logs 12 years ago
Andrew Tridgell 89f121ea77 DataFlash: wait for blocks to finish writing to flash on log read 12 years ago
Andrew Tridgell 7de47931a8 DataFlash: use %f not %.6f 12 years ago
Randy Mackay 4b18c670e3 DataFlash: explicitly print floats to 6 dec places 12 years ago
Andrew Tridgell 469736e6bc DataFlash: changes for GPS field changes 12 years ago
Andrew Tridgell 411e940342 DataFlash: prevent the dataflash erase problem 12 years ago
Andrew Tridgell 0242d50ad4 DataFlash: added Log_Write_Message() 12 years ago
Andrew Tridgell 709a277c7f DataFlash: chamged FMT message to include labels 12 years ago
Andrew Tridgell 844e1b9ef9 DataFlash: added support for printing flight mode as a string 12 years ago
Andrew Tridgell 62f190ed15 DataFlash: simplify code now that copter is converted 12 years ago
Andrew Tridgell cf0c8331c2 DataFlash: use print_latlon() 12 years ago
Andrew Tridgell c29d870497 DataFlash: dump the format of logs at the start of the log 12 years ago
Andrew Tridgell 916e8d0992 DataFlash: new dataflash logging system 12 years ago
Andrew Tridgell da5a5ea368 DataFlash: added file based 'dataflash' logging 12 years ago
Andrew Tridgell a7541e9ad3 DataFlash: report log number when starting a new log 12 years ago
Andrew Tridgell 7b524d15fa DataFlash: added log_num to dump interface 12 years ago
Andrew Tridgell c52ef80f06 DataFlash: added Block layer in classes 12 years ago
Andrew Tridgell 0ffcffa81c DataFlash: fixed signed/unsigned errors in API 12 years ago
Andrew Tridgell 9b551f162c DataFlash: make the public interface much narrower 12 years ago
Andrew Tridgell 20825cc903 DataFlash: removed the byte and word based interfaces 12 years ago
Andrew Tridgell c6b006cf5f DataFlash: move log reading logic into common library 12 years ago
Andrew Tridgell 28a0ba6c4a DataFlash: added block based dataflash writes 12 years ago
Pat Hickey 7b9b088261 DataFlash: AP_HAL port fixups 12 years ago
Pat Hickey 8ffec83b73 DataFlash: fixes to lib include and make the test smaller 12 years ago
uncrustify 2e97fd3e9f uncrustify libraries/DataFlash/DataFlash.cpp 13 years ago
rmackay9 2b24e422de DataFlash: revert delay callbacks to use "unsigned long" 13 years ago
rmackay9 20cb2e56a0 DataFlash: change "unsigned long" to "uint32_t" in callback functions 13 years ago
rmackay9 94552b57a7 DataFlash: replaced "int" with "int16_t" 13 years ago
Andrew Tridgell e171720608 DataFlash: fixed SITL build 13 years ago
Jason Short 3ca57ac105 DataFlash : Removed Chip Erase - relying on Block erase only 13 years ago
Craig Elder 6d3fdfc03a DataFlash: The current method for checking if chip erase worked is producing false positives. We are forcing the block erase until we have a deterministic test method. 13 years ago
Andrew Tridgell dd24330645 DataFlash: fallback to BlockErase if ChipErase fails 13 years ago
Andrew Tridgell fc73fd6531 DataFlash: use ChipErase() instead of PageErase() on all pages 13 years ago
Andrew Tridgell 5e4f66e525 DataFlash: moved high level logging logic to library 13 years ago